According to Chilean President Gabriel Boric. The nation’s lithium industry will be nationalised, and a state-owned corporation will be established to produce the metal. Which is a crucial component of the batteries use in electric vehicles.
However, It would only be made through state-controlled public-private partnerships. Chile is the second-biggest producer of lithium and has the largest lithium reserves in the world.

The following are significant facts about the world’s lithium market.
Currently, hard rocks or brine mines generate lithium.
Australia is the largest provider in the world and produces from hard rocks
mines. Salt lakes are the main source of production in Argentina, Chile, and
China.
LITHIUM PRODUCTION
The world produced 737,000 tonnes of lithium carbonate’s equivalent (LCE) in
2022. And it is anticipate to reach 964,000 tonnes in 2023 & 1,167,000 tonnes
in 2024, according to the Australian Department of Industries, Science,
Resources and Energy Quarterly Report from March.
Gains in output are anticipate in Australia, Chile, and Argentina to
accommodate rapid expansion.
By Talison Lithium, a partnership between Tianqi Lithium, IGO, and Albemarle
(NYSE:ALB) Corp., in Greenbushes, Western Australia. Currently, 1.34 million
tonnes of chemical- & technical-grade lithium concentrate may be produce
annually.
Spodumene concentrate is produce at Pilgangoora, Western Australia, which
is owne by Pilbara Minerals. Two extensions are currently under construction
to boost annual production capability to one million tonnes.
